You can tell if your lawn needs dethatching in Olney by examining the thatch layer's thickness. If you notice a layer of dead grass and organic material that is over half an inch thick, it's time to consider dethatching. Additionally, signs such as poor drainage, uneven growth, and water pooling can indicate that the thatch is inhibiting root access to essential nutrients. If you find that your grass is brown or patchy despite proper care, dethatching may help revitalize your lawn. Performing a simple tug test can also help; if you can easily pull up a clump of grass with roots attached, dethatching is likely needed.
In Olney, the frequency of lawn dethatching largely depends on the type of grass and the amount of thatch accumulation. For most homeowners, dethatching once every 1-3 years is sufficient, especially if you have a healthy lawn and practice regular maintenance. However, if you have a lawn that tends to develop thatch quickly due to heavy foot traffic or poor soil conditions, you may need to dethatch more frequently, possibly once a year. Monitoring your lawn's health and the thickness of the thatch layer will help you determine the best schedule for dethatching to ensure a thriving and resilient lawn.
After dethatching your lawn in Olney, you can expect noticeable improvements in grass health and vitality over time. Initially, your lawn may appear somewhat distressed due to the removal of thatch, but with proper care, it will rebound quickly. The removal of thatch allows for better air circulation, water absorption, and nutrient penetration, leading to stronger root development. Within a few weeks, you should start to see new growth and a more robust lawn overall. It's also beneficial to follow up with fertilization and watering to support recovery and enhance the benefits of dethatching.
Lawn dethatching is the process of removing the layer of thatch, a buildup of dead grass, roots, and organic material that can accumulate on the soil surface. In Olney, dethatching is necessary because excessive thatch can prevent water, air, and nutrients from reaching the grass roots, leading to a weaker lawn. By dethatching, you promote healthier grass growth, improve root penetration, and enhance overall lawn resilience. This process is particularly important for cool-season grasses common in the area, as they can easily become suffocated by thick layers of thatch. Regular dethatching is an essential part of maintaining a healthy and vibrant lawn.
The best time to dethatch your lawn in Olney typically falls during the growing season, either in early spring or early fall. Dethatching in spring allows your lawn to recover quickly as temperatures rise and growth accelerates. Conversely, dethatching in early fall prepares the grass for winter while promoting strong growth in the following spring. It's important to assess the thickness of the thatch layer before proceeding; if it's more than half an inch thick, dethatching is advisable.
